As far as the subwoofer goes, here is how I would proceed. Boats can vary within the same year and model, which is especially true in the case of heaters. I would begin by making my model of the cardboard or posterboard subwoofer enclosure. Make it the maximum size and shape that will fit the space, clear cables and vents, and accommodate the legroom that you are willing or not willing to give up. You can also verify the ease of insertion/removal. From there you have a maximum external displacement which easily converts into a gross internal displacement. From there you have the concise data needed to select a subwoofer size, the best type of loading (whether sealed or bass-reflex), and the subwoofer with the parameters that best match that enclosure. Downsizing the model a bit for whatever final enclosure design you choose is a walk in the park.
